* Low cost
* Low leakage
* Low forward voltage drop
* High current capability
* High surge current capability
FEATURES
MECHANICAL DATA
*Case: Molded plastic
* Epoxy: UL 94V-0 rated flame retardant
*Lead: MIL-STD-202E, Method 208 guaranteed
*Polarity: Color band denotes cathode end
* Mounting position: Any
*Weight: 2.08 gram approx.
Note 1: Measured at 1 MHz and applied reverse voltage of 4.0 volts.
Note 2: Typical thermal resistance from junction to ambient.
